Abstract
This paper introduces a generalization of cellular automata in which each celi is a tape-bounded Turing machine rather than a finite-state machine. Fast algorithms are given for performing various basic image processing tasks by such automata. It is suggested that this model of parallel computation is a very suitable one for studying the advantages of parallelism in this domain.
